Q3. what are 4 pillars of oops
Encapsulation, Inheritance, Polymorphism, Abstraction
Encapsulation: Bundling data and methods that operate on the data into a single unit. Example: Class in Java
Inheritance: Ability of a class to inherit properties and behavior from another class. Example: Parent class and child class relationship
Polymorphism: Ability to present the same interface for different data types. Example: Method overloading and method overriding

Q6. diode circuits with resistor in series
Diode circuits with resistor in series are commonly used to control current flow and voltage levels in electronic circuits.
When a diode is connected in series with a resistor, the current flowing through the circuit is limited by the resistor.
The voltage drop across the diode remains relatively constant, while the voltage drop across the resistor depends on the current flowing through it.

Q7. What is the value of Epsilon
Epsilon is a small positive value used in numerical calculations to represent a very small number.
Epsilon is typically used in computer programming to compare floating-point numbers for equality.
It is often denoted as 'ε' and is usually a very small number close to zero.
For example, in C programming, the value of epsilon can be defined as FLT_EPSILON for float data type or DBL_EPSILON for double data type.

Q10. Tell me about Transformers.
Transformers are electrical devices that transfer energy between two or more circuits through electromagnetic induction.
Transformers consist of primary and secondary coils wound around a core
They can step up or step down voltage levels
Examples include power transformers used in electricity distribution and audio transformers in amplifiers

Q12. what are sensor
Sensors are devices that detect and respond to input from the physical environment.
Sensors convert physical quantities into electrical signals for processing.
They are used in various applications such as temperature sensing, motion detection, and proximity sensing.
Examples include thermocouples for temperature measurement, accelerometers for motion detection, and proximity sensors for object detection.
